Introduction

When it comes to beauty routines, removing lash glue effectively is crucial for maintaining healthy natural lashes. Lash glue can be strong and sometimes difficult to remove, leading to potential damage if not done properly. This is where a reliable lash glue remover comes into play. Designed specifically for this purpose, lash glue removers help dissolve the adhesive used for false eyelashes, making the removal process smoother and safer.

Using a quality lash glue remover not only protects your natural lashes but also ensures that your skin remains irritation-free. Many users appreciate the convenience of a quick and easy application, often requiring just a few minutes to work its magic. Here are some key benefits of using lash glue removers:
  • Gentle on the skin
  • Prevents lash damage
  • Quick and effective
  • Easy to use
For those who frequently apply and remove false lashes, investing in a good lash glue remover is essential. It is important to choose a product that is proven quality and customer-approved, ensuring that you can trust it with your beauty routine. Remember to follow the instructions provided with the remover for the best results. FAQs

Look for a lash glue remover that is gentle, effective, and suitable for your skin type. Reading customer reviews and checking for proven quality can also guide your choice.

Key features include being oil-free, hypoallergenic, quick-drying, and easy to apply. Ensure it is specifically designed for lash glue to avoid irritation.

Yes, common mistakes include using too much product, not following the instructions, or being too aggressive during removal, which can damage natural lashes.

Regular makeup removers may not be effective against lash glue and can lead to irritation. It is best to use a product specifically formulated for lash glue.

Use lash glue remover only when you are removing false lashes. Avoid using it too frequently to protect your natural lashes from potential damage.
